Abstract

The utility model relates to an intelligent monitoring socks that prevention was gone astray from group, including sock body last piezoelectric sensor, data processor and the signal transceiver of installing of sock body. Through inciting somebody to action the utility model discloses a intelligent monitoring socks are dressed on patient's senile dementia foot, can prevent patient senile dementia to run away from home night, need not the household and accompany and attend to constantly by patient's senile dementia body, have solved household's puzzlement.

As it is shown in figure 1, the intellectual monitoring socks that a kind of prevention is gone astray from the group, including sock body, wherein sock body includes socks body 1 and socks waist 2, and socks body 1 includes heel portion 11 and ball portion 12.
Being provided with the piezoelectric transducer 3 for producing voltage when sensing that wearer pressure applied is oppressed in sock body, piezoelectric transducer 3 is preferably mounted at the heel portion 11 of sock body, so contributes to sensing wearer pressure applied.
Wherein, piezoelectric transducer 3 is preferably prepared from by piezo-electric electret thin film material.Piezo-electric electret thin film material is the electret film material that a class has piezoelectric effect or inverse piezoelectric effect.Piezo-electric electret thin film material is preferably by polypropylene (Polypropylene, PP), politef (Polytetrafluoroethylene, PTFE), polyethylene terephthalate (Polyethyleneterephthalate, PET) or poly phthalate (Polyethylenenaphthalate, PEN) be prepared from.Piezo-electric electret thin film material can also be prepared from by cyclenes copolymer (Cyclo-olefincopolymer, COC), fluorinated ethylene propylene copolymer (Fluorinatedethylenepropylenecopolymer, FEP) etc..Such as: the piezo-electric electret etc. of the sandwich of polypropylene foam piezo-electric electret (Polypropylenefoampiezoelectret, PP), solid FEP or expanded PTFE or solid FEP composition.Owing to piezo-electric electret thin film material is based on polymeric material, therefore there is the general characteristic of polymeric material, for instance light weight (gram level), thickness thin (micron order), material softness are prone to bending, adapt to various environment (corrosion-resistant, waterproof), nontoxic environmental protection, (polymeric film yield is very big) with low cost etc..Certainly in other embodiments, piezoelectric transducer 3 also can be prepared from by piezoquartz (Piezoelectriccrystal) or piezoelectric ceramics (Piezoelectricceramic).
Being also equipped with the data processor 4 being connected with piezoelectric transducer 3 in sock body, this data processor 4 is preferably attached on socks waist 2, can also be installed on socks body 1 in other embodiments.Data processor 4 can be MCU processor conventional in prior art, is used for processing logical operations etc..This data processor 4 includes computing unit, memory element, comparing unit and alarm unit.Wherein computing unit is for being mass value corresponding to pressure applied by photovoltaic conversion, memory element is for storing set threshold value, comparing unit is for comparing mass value and set threshold value and judge whether to send alarm signal, when mass value is more than set threshold value, alarm unit produces alarm signal.Wherein, set threshold value is less than the body weight value of wearer, it is preferable that range for 30Kg-60Kg, it is possible to for 30Kg, 40Kg, 50Kg or 60Kg.
Being also equipped with the signal transceiver 5 being connected with data processor 4 in sock body, signal transceiver 5 is preferably attached on socks waist 2, can also be installed on socks body 1 in other embodiments.This signal transceiver 5 is used for receiving the alarm signal that data processor 4 sends the intelligent terminal that this alarm signal is sent to the external world.Extraneous intelligent terminal can be mobile phone or IPAD etc., and the transmission means of alarm signal is preferably and is wirelessly transferred, such as bluetooth or WIFI etc..This alarm signal mainly shows in the way of sound or vibration.
Before senile dementia patients sleeping at night, intellectual monitoring socks are worn on foot, will stand and then touch piezoelectric transducer 3 when unconsciously wanting to run away from home after senile dementia patients sleeping process is waken up, simultaneously by default threshold value is set in below senile dementia body weight for humans, after then senile dementia patients stands, it drops on the body weight on piezoelectric transducer 3 and necessarily exceedes threshold value and then send alarm signal and be sent to the intelligent terminal of its household, make household will find the situation that senile dementia patients is likely run away from home at once, without constantly accompanying and attending at senile dementia patients by the side of, solve the puzzlement of household.
Being also equipped with positioning tracker 6 in sock body, this positioning tracker 6, it is also preferred that be installed on socks waist 2, can also be installed on socks body 1 in other embodiments.This positioning tracker 6 is connected with signal transceiver 5, and by signal transceiver 5 from positioning tracker 6 receive locating and tracking information and locating and tracking information is sent to the external world intelligent terminal.Positioning tracker 6 can follow the tracks of system for GPS people, wearer positional information is formed after collecting signal at any time, the related personnel that need to understand wearer positional information is achieved with the particular location of wearer by sending short message by mobile phone to relative address, can be additionally seen concrete bit space residing for wearer even with satellite photo to put, thus completing the monitoring at any time to wearer, prevent senile dementia patients from going astray from the group further.
Being also equipped with rechargeable battery 7 in sock body, this rechargeable battery 7, it is also preferred that be installed on socks waist 2, can also be installed on socks body 1 in other embodiments.Rechargeable battery 7 electrically connects with piezoelectric transducer 3, data processor 4, signal transceiver 5 and positioning tracker 6 respectively, is that piezoelectric transducer 3, data processor 4, signal transceiver 5 and positioning tracker 6 are powered by rechargeable battery 7.This rechargeable battery 7 can pass through power source charges, it is also possible to is charged by the mode of wireless charging.
It addition, sock body includes internal layer and outer layer, wherein internal layer is preferably formed by the cotton thread of pro-skin is knitting, can also be prepared from by other knitting fabric in other embodiments;Outer layer is prepared from by wear-resistant cloth, it is preferably fire-retardant wear-resistant cloth to be prepared from, and piezoelectric transducer 3, data processor 4, signal transceiver 5, positioning tracker 6 and rechargeable battery 7 are embedded in outer layer, the problem that when dressing by using wear-resistant cloth to avoid, above-mentioned piezoelectric transducer 3, data processor 4, signal transceiver 5, positioning tracker 6 and rechargeable battery 7 are easily damaged.
In other embodiments, also accompanying flexible insulating layer between internal layer and outer layer, flexible insulating barrier can make wearer feel more comfortable on the one hand, also makes wearer increase safety when dressing on the other hand.
